    Maxtor External Network Storage

    Just curious, has anyone had any experience with this unit?



    • Add storage and share files, photos, and music
    • Access files from multiple PCs
    • Easy installation - Automatic network configuration
    • Easy browser interface to assign privacy levels for shared folders
    • Drag and Sort™ file organization
    • 2 USB ports let you add shared printers or extra drives
    • 100Base-T / 10Base-T Ethernet connection
    • 200GB and 300GB capacities
    I saw this at Costco for $389.99.

    I'm looking to add an additional external drive for storgage. I'm interested in the network solution. I currently have a drive enclusure and it is being shared, but sometimes my computer locks up and my wife can't get access to the drive.

    Or I could just buy a network drive enclosure and transfering my existing drive to it. Something like this:



    This would cost me about C$145.

    I have one of the older Maxtor One-Touch drives. There's no reasonable way to open the enclosure and replace the drive. If it dies I can break the case open or throw the whole thing away.

    If I were you I'd go for the build it myself method using the network drive enclosure

        Those Maxtor are sealed like no one's business, they DO NOT want you putting new HDs into the thing.

        IMO, you're better to get an external enclosure with ethernet abilities and be able to put what HD you want in it. Then just swap out HDs whenever you want to.

          I have a similar drive from Lacie, was able to swap out the 80GB maxtor drive and replace it with my 250GB Western digital drive.

          I know they have network versions out now as well, the cases are well made and relatively easy to get into.

            Just to update this thread - there are a number of barebone systems on the market now. I personally have a NAS drive by a company called Synology. The unit come supplied a an empty case, you open up the case and simply add your own HDD (SATA or ATA). The unit features full NAS features, FTP access, & Web Server. There's also a handy USB Flash Card copy function and the ability to add on other USB drives.
